Easy Chicken Parmesan Recipe with Crispy Breaded Chicken

Easy Chicken Parmesan Recipe

Crispy pan-fried chicken cutlets are finished with marinara, mozzarella, and Parmesan for a comforting dinner that serves four. The chicken stays crunchy because the sauce is spooned mostly around and underneath the breading.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ings: 4 servings

Ingredients
  

Chicken
  • 2 large, about 1½ pounds total Large bo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 teaspoon, divided Kosher salt
  • ½ teaspoon, divided Black pepper
Breading
  • ½ cup All-purpose flour
  • 2 large Large eggs
  • 1 tablespoon Water
  • 1 cup Italian-seasoned breadcrumbs or panko breadcrumbs
  • ½ cup, divided Finely gr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• ½ teaspoon Garlic powder
For Cooking and Topping
  • ¼ cup Olive oil or neutral cooking oil
  • 1½ to 2 cups Marinara sauce

  • 2 tablespoons, chopped, optional Fresh parsley or basil

Method
 

Step-by-Step
  1. Heat the oven to 425°F. Slice the chicken breasts horizontally into four cutlets, place them between sheets of plastic wrap, and gently pound them to an even thickness of about ½ inch.
  2. Season both sides of the chicken with the divided kosher salt and black pepper. Set out three shallow bowls: flour in the first, beaten eggs mixed with water in the second, and breadcrumbs mixed with ¼ cup Parmesan, Italian seasoning, and garlic powder in the third.
  3. Dredge each cutlet in flour, shaking off the excess. Dip it into the egg mixture, then press it firmly into the breadcrumb mixture so the coating covers every surface.
  4. Heat the oil in a large o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the breaded chicken for about 2–3 minutes per side, working in batches if needed, until the coating is golden brown.
  5. Spoon the marinara sauce into the skillet and around the chicken. Keep most of the sauce underneath or beside the cutlets instead of completely covering the crispy tops.
  6. Sprinkle the chicken with the shredded mozzarella and the remaining Parmesan. Transfer the oven-safe skillet to the 425°F oven and bake for 12–15 minutes.
  7. Check the thickest part of the chicken with an instant-read thermometer; it should reach 165°F. If desired, broil for 1–2 minutes at the end, watching closely, until the cheese is lightly browned and bubbling.
  8. Remove the skillet from the oven and rest the chicken for about 5 minutes. Garnish with chopped parsley or basil, then serve with pasta, salad, or garlic bread.

Notes

Panko gives the coating extra crunch, while regular Italian breadcrumbs create a more traditional texture. Freshly grated Parmesan blends into the breading especially well. Leftovers should be refrigerated and reheated in a hot oven or air fryer to help restore crispness.
